Since their hasn't been a firmware update in about a year, I'd like to bring up the list of wanted features that people came up with. The original thread is here:

Here was the original list:

What are the things you think need fixed or improved?

1. Improve user interface so it is easier to use.
2. Improve file system to work with nested folders and other modern standards
3. Improve the track slowdown feature. Currently this feature sounds terrible and is basically unusable in my opinion. Try downloading the demo of the "Amazing Slow Downer" for an example of how it should sound.
4. A/B Looping: Add an easy way to loop sections of a song.
5. Basic standard transport controls for backing track playback.
6. Start the amp where I left off. If I turn the amp off while on preset 53, start me at 53 when I turn it back on.
7. Improve FUSE software. As is it is very clunky and buggy and seems to follow few usability standards. It would also be great to have an easy way to reorganize presets on the amp with FUSE.
8. Address noise issues on some presets, amp models and effects.
9. Allow recording to an SD card until full
10. Add the function to have a preset bank on the SD card, or at least make presets on the SD card easy to access.
11. Improve current amps and effects and add new ones
12. Ability to access the three QA Presets with the foot switch or touch buttons from Preset Mode without it stopping playback of assigned backing track and starting new backing track from the new QA preset. We need to be able to finish the song in progress AND be able to change the QA presets during the song. This is a major performance flaw.
13. Ability to assign 3 unique QA Presets per Amp Preset, with the ability to change to the QA Presets WITHOUT stopping playback of the current backing track.
14. Setlist or Playlist feature.


A few things of my own:

15. Allow tweaking of stompboxes/effects in Fuse using the arrow keys in addition to the mouse. Too hard to tweak using the mouse.
16. Start where the amp left off. If I end on preset #50, that's where I want to start I know that this is #6 above but this is a really big one to fix!!
17. Need the ability to move patches around in Fuse by dragging them. If I want to swap patches #2 and #3 I want to drag them with the mouse not have to save over them. This would be my biggest request. Many other multi-effects processors and modeling amps have this feature - why not Fender?
18. Add a "date created" or "date imported" field to Fender Fuse. I import a lot of patches and it gets hard to find them in Fuse. I'd like to be able to sort by date so that I can find the ones that I recently imported.
19. Need a way to set the quick access presets from Fuse rather than only on the amp.
20. Allow the 2nd guitar input on the back of the amp to use a different tone than the one on the front.
21. On Fender Sound Community, display the amp used, effects, etc. without having to download the patch. Sometimes I'm looking for a tone with a specific effect and I'd liek to filter for that effect.
22. Get rid of the clicking that happens when using the foot pedal to switch tones.
23. Add some more amps/effects/stompboxes. Even if you charge for them individually - I'd pay for a Blues Driver stompbox!



I hope someone from Fender actually looks at these discussion boards. There are a lot of great features with this amp (I have the GDec 3 30) but there are some serious flaws. I wouldn't recommend anyone purchase this until Fender addresses these issues. A few fixes and the GDec will be the best modeling amp on the market!!
